Abstract:
The present invention relates to dew resistant coatings and articles having the dew resistant coating adhered thereto. The dew resistant coatings comprise elongate silica particles. These coatings are useful on articles or surfaces used in outdoor applications and articles and surfaces used in moist indoor environments.
Abstract:
A system and method are disclosed for providing efficient data storage. A plurality of data segments is received in a data stream. The system determines whether a data segment has been stored previously in a low latency memory. In the event that the data segment is determined to have been stored previously, an identifier for the previously stored data segment is returned.

Abstract:
This invention relates to labels. In one embodiment, the labels comprise (A) a polymer film comprising a styrenic polymer, said film having an upper surface and a lower surface, and an MVTR of from about 15 to about 150 g/m2/day, and (B) a water-based adhesive in contact with the lower surface of the film. These labels can be bonded to substrates of glass, plastic or metal using the water based adhesive.

Abstract:
A baseline wander correcting unit is provided in a processing path in which a predetermined processing is performed on an input signal. The baseline wander correcting unit includes a baseline wander derivation unit which derives an amount of wander of baseline of a signal on which the predetermined processing has been performed, and an adjustment unit which adjusts an amount of wander of the baseline derived by the baseline wander derivation unit and outputs a baseline correction amount, so that the baseline wander correcting unit corrects the baseline wander by a feedforward control. The correction by the feedforward control ensures the baseline wander in the event of an instantaneous wander.
Abstract:
A signal processing apparatus has a plurality of baseline wander correcting units, provided in a processing path in which a predetermined processing is performed on an input signal. Baseline wander of the signal is corrected sequentially by each of the plurality of baseline wander correcting units. At least a baseline wander correcting unit placed in the initial stage may correct baseline wander by a feedback control. The baseline wander correcting units correct the baseline wanders, respectively, so that the wander of baseline can be efficiently corrected.
